Output e4e83687f7f18bdc0448f44b830083f2ad2bbd69d65dbb56ae8fdeb07c688d8f:1

value
2654588491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7323bd6e67f90a3bf6f6f40c2acb8f425605ba9 OP_EQUAL
address
3JPfkx6Sv7ikie5Y477Ae7H16QgRbr7NAY
transaction
e4e83687f7f18bdc0448f44b830083f2ad2bbd69d65dbb56ae8fdeb07c688d8f
confirmations
507797
spent
true